A cord clips to each bit ring and then passes upwards and through a loop on each side of a poll strap.

Raising the head causes the length of the chambon along the cheekpieces to shorten and thus puts reciprocal pressure on the horse's mouth and on the horse's poll. When a horse is lunged correctly, and the chambon is correctly adjusted, the horse stretches down and raises his back. If the chambon is too loose, the horse will trail his quarters and little muscle development will be achieved. If not, the horse may not understand that it needs to lower its head in response to the pressure, and thus may panic when it feels the upward and ungiving pressure on the bit, and possibly rear. It applies pressure to the poll and mouth of the horse when he raises his head, releasing when the horse stretches long and low, down toward the ground. Horses generally dislike pressure behind the poll and learn to release the pressure by lowering their head, and when in motion, this encourages the horse to relax its back and bring its hindquarters further under its body, thus encouraging collection. If fitted too tightly, the horse will draw his neck back and become overbent. Chambons can also cause sore neck muscles if overused.
